Jerry Bruckheimer: The Maestro of High-Octane Cinema Jerry Bruckheimer is a name synonymous with big-budget, high-energy blockbusters that have captivated audiences for decades. As one of the most prolific and successful film producers in Hollywood, Bruckheimer has an uncanny ability to deliver action-packed, visually stunning cinematic experiences that keep viewers on the edge of their seats. Bruckheimer's career spans a diverse range of genres, from the adrenaline-fueled antics of the "Bad Boys" and "Pirates of the Caribbean" franchises to the epic historical sagas of "Pearl Harbor" and "Black Hawk Down." His collaborations with renowned directors like Tony Scott, Michael Bay, and Gore Verbinski have resulted in some of the most iconic and influential films of our time, showcasing his talent for blending high-octane thrills with emotional depth and character development. Whether he's exploring the inner workings of the U.S. military, the high-stakes world of law enforcement, or the mysteries of the high seas, Bruckheimer brings a relentless energy and attention to detail that elevates each project he touches. Beyond his impressive filmography, Bruckheimer's enduring impact on the industry is evidenced by his ability to consistently deliver box office hits and cultivate lasting fan bases. From the exhilarating aerial stunts of "Top Gun" to the swashbuckling adventures of the "Pirates" series, his films have become cultural touchstones, captivating audiences with their larger-than-life spectacle and undeniable entertainment value. As a true master of his craft, Jerry Bruckheimer continues to push the boundaries of what's possible in cinematic storytelling, cementing his legacy as one of the most influential producers in the history of Hollywood.
